8-Year-Old Boy Missing in Vantaa
An 8-year-old boy has gone missing in Vantaa, and police are urging anyone with information to contact emergency services.
A police report from the Eastern Uusimaa area states that an 8-year-old boy went missing in Myyrmäki, Vantaa on Thursday around 1:30 PM. The last known sighting of the boy was at the Vantaankoski train station. Authorities believe he may be traveling by local train in the Vantaa or Helsinki areas.
The missing boy was last seen wearing a black jacket, black outdoor pants, and winter boots. He was also carrying a black backpack featuring a white Puma text and logo. The police are actively seeking the public's assistance and urge anyone who might have seen the child or knows his whereabouts to report to emergency services by calling 112.
